| Index: remoting/host/video_frame_capturer_fake.cc
|
| diff --git a/remoting/host/video_frame_capturer_fake.cc b/remoting/host/video_frame_capturer_fake.cc
|
| index eaf8f5c9a943514a99abbb93e71ad0803dcc2601..0fff545dc0802e9b41bd8fcfb5d3879192b5c815 100644
|
| --- a/remoting/host/video_frame_capturer_fake.cc
|
| +++ b/remoting/host/video_frame_capturer_fake.cc
|
| @@ -44,42 +44,18 @@ void VideoFrameCapturerFake::Start(const CursorShapeChangedCallback& callback) {
|
| void VideoFrameCapturerFake::Stop() {
|
| }
|
|
|
| -void VideoFrameCapturerFake::ScreenConfigurationChanged() {
|
| - size_ = SkISize::Make(kWidth, kHeight);
|
| - bytes_per_row_ = size_.width() * kBytesPerPixel;
|
| - pixel_format_ = media::VideoFrame::RGB32;
|
| -
|
| - // Create memory for the buffers.
|
| - int buffer_size = size_.height() * bytes_per_row_;
|
| - for (int i = 0; i < kNumBuffers; i++) {
|
| - buffers_[i].reset(new uint8[buffer_size]);
|
| - }
|
| -}
|
| -
|
| media::VideoFrame::Format VideoFrameCapturerFake::pixel_format() const {
|
| return pixel_format_;
|
| }
|
|
|
| -void VideoFrameCapturerFake::ClearInvalidRegion() {
|
| - helper_.ClearInvalidRegion();
|
| -}
|
| -
|
| void VideoFrameCapturerFake::InvalidateRegion(const SkRegion& invalid_region) {
|
| helper_.InvalidateRegion(invalid_region);
|
| }
|
|
|
| -void VideoFrameCapturerFake::InvalidateScreen(const SkISize& size) {
|
| - helper_.InvalidateScreen(size);
|
| -}
|
| -
|
| -void VideoFrameCapturerFake::InvalidateFullScreen() {
|
| - helper_.InvalidateFullScreen();
|
| -}
|
| -
|
| void VideoFrameCapturerFake::CaptureInvalidRegion(
|
| const CaptureCompletedCallback& callback) {
|
| GenerateImage();
|
| - InvalidateScreen(size_);
|
| + helper_.InvalidateScreen(size_);
|
|
|
| SkRegion invalid_region;
|
| helper_.SwapInvalidRegion(&invalid_region);
|
| @@ -136,4 +112,16 @@ void VideoFrameCapturerFake::GenerateImage() {
|
| }
|
| }
|
|
|
| +void VideoFrameCapturerFake::ScreenConfigurationChanged() {
|
| + size_ = SkISize::Make(kWidth, kHeight);
|
| + bytes_per_row_ = size_.width() * kBytesPerPixel;
|
| + pixel_format_ = media::VideoFrame::RGB32;
|
| +
|
| + // Create memory for the buffers.
|
| + int buffer_size = size_.height() * bytes_per_row_;
|
| + for (int i = 0; i < kNumBuffers; i++) {
|
| + buffers_[i].reset(new uint8[buffer_size]);
|
| + }
|
| +}
|
| +
|
| } // namespace remoting
|
|
|